水平连铸复合Al-10%Pb-钢背轴瓦材料的组织研究
Research of Microstructure of Al-10%Pb-Steel Bearing Material in Process of Horizontal Continuous Casting
【摘要】 采用水平连铸复合的方法,在冷却速度达到80℃/s的条件下,将Al 10%Pb合金熔体直接铸造复合到钢背上获得Al 10%Pb 钢背轴瓦材料。研究结果表明,在Al 10%Pb合金组织中,球状的铅相颗粒分布均匀、平均直径<13μm;Al 10%Pb 钢背轴瓦材料过渡层为舌状组织结构,这种舌状过渡层组织由FeAl、Fe2Al5和FeAl3相组成。
【Abstract】 Under the cooling rate 80℃/s, an Al-10%Pb-steel backing bearing material was obtained by casting Al-10%Pb melt onto steel backing in the process of horizontal continuous casting. The experimental results indicate that no gravity segregation existed in Al-10%Pb alloy. The little and spherical Pb particles were dispersed in Al matrix and their sizes were below 13μm. The microstructure of transition zone of the bearing material was ligule-shape which was composed of FeAl, Fe2Al5 and FeAl3.
